Answer: 0.069\times 10^{-24}

Explanation: Atomic mass unit (amu) is used to define the atomic mass of the substance.

1 amu= 1.66\times 10^{-24}g

Thus given mass= 1.66\times 10^{-24}g

\text{Number of moles}=\frac{\text{Given mass}}{\text{Molar mass}}

\text{Number of moles}=\frac{1.66\times 10^{-24}g}{24g/mol}=0.069\times 10^{-24}

Now 1 mole of a substance = 1 gram atom

0.069\times 10^{-24}  moles of a substance =\frac{1}{1}\times 0.069\times 10^{-24}=0.069\times 10^{-24} gram atom
